About

Martin Garbade is a scholar working on Environmental Engineering, Geology and Computer Vision and Pattern Recognition. According to data from OpenAlex, Martin Garbade has authored 4 papers receiving a total of 107 indexed citations (citations by other indexed papers that have themselves been cited), including 2 papers in Environmental Engineering, 2 papers in Geology and 1 paper in Computer Vision and Pattern Recognition. Recurrent topics in Martin Garbade's work include Remote Sensing and LiDAR Applications (2 papers), 3D Surveying and Cultural Heritage (2 papers) and Geographic Information Systems Studies (1 paper). Martin Garbade is often cited by papers focused on Remote Sensing and LiDAR Applications (2 papers), 3D Surveying and Cultural Heritage (2 papers) and Geographic Information Systems Studies (1 paper). Martin Garbade collaborates with scholars based in Germany. Martin Garbade's co-authors include Jan Quenzel, Jens Behley, Andres Milioto, Sven Behnke, Cyrill Stachniss, Jürgen Gall and Jüergen Gall and has published in prestigious journals such as The International Journal of Robotics Research and arXiv (Cornell University).
